Transaction 6588c01657ffcf72802752ecce165ab423c1ce6b3ad4125c90f79ce22f8bb777

1 Input
2 Outputs
  • 6588c01657ffcf72802752ecce165ab423c1ce6b3ad4125c90f79ce22f8bb777:0
  • value  1710500
    address  3LSCYkMzJhAtGJRFfNcq6LLdtfMB8AosgN
  • 6588c01657ffcf72802752ecce165ab423c1ce6b3ad4125c90f79ce22f8bb777:1
  • value  11910518
    address  1HWd68C7fUGxjiQYPRjAXfYotdSUJToHrP